Our loved one, Margaree Dowdy McFarland, went home to be with the Lord. She made her transition on Tuesday, February 24, 2026, at Carolina Pines Regional Medical Center under Hospice Care. Because she had fought a good fight, finished her course and kept the faith, she knew it was alright to go home to be with the Lord.
Margaree was born September 29, 1927, in Hartsville, SC. She was raised by Oree Jenkins and Edmond Isaac, Sr. She was educated in the Darlington County Public School System and Kay Branch School. Margaree services in the work industry included: culinary arts at the Lake Shore Restaurant and Carolina Lunch, and environmental services. She retired from Byerly Hospital and then retired a second time from Carolina Pines Regional Medical Center.
Margaree was a lifelong member of Kay Branch Missionary Baptist Church. She found joy in the simple pleasures of life. She loved watching westerns, cooking, gardening, and spending time studying and reading the Bible. She was a lover of animals and always kept a cat or dog around the house, she made certain of that, even if we didn’t.
